Just to add to this post, we've used our companion voucher with Iberia for MAD-SCL, EZE-MAD. 102K Avios plus £440 in taxes for 2 business class seats. A huge saving compared to BA.
We booked separate IB flights down to MAD, which at £75 pp each way was a bit of a no-brainer. If you try to add these into the overall CV booking, you're getting stung for additional avios and taxes. I don't think it's worth it, and you might as well fly BA.
HOWEVER..... Last night we called BA to book our next trip with IB; Madrid - Costa Rica over the Xmas periood. What was really interesting is the agent told me that Iberia release their award seats 4-5 days ahead of BA, and they can book past the 355 days on their system. No £35 fees charges for booking over the phone for that date in the future.
So we've got MAD-SJO on Dec 24th, flying home on Jan 7th - a date that's not accessible as of today on BA.com date picker.
Something to keep in mind if you're chasing Madrid to Tokyo (or any other lucrative IB route).... call them up as they can see beyond the 355 days!
